    Im looking at some enkie wheels for my 93 4 door. They are 16x7 114 +38. I want to run a 215/50 tire. I looked at teh other post with the +15 and the 0 offsets. Looks sick but I cant pull this off with the kids etc having to ride in my hooptie. lol. Should I have any problems with the set up? Thanks

              Enkei Nt03's 16x7 +38 offsett, on Maxxis 225/45/16 tires.

              my silver set


              My black set


              I'm on H&R coilovers and they don't rub at all, even with my 5 and 3yr olds in the back seat. I also have a full size NT03 spare in the trunk as well.

                +38 is a good safe offset to run, and for the tires look at 215/45's they are a good size tire. my personal opinion the 215/50 might be a lil to chunk.

                215/45r16 16x7 +40
